Output 57d82dd80d4e6c9d3005cce9e9dd5df5a4820cb0ceedc3eb102f136cc669c8ed:0

value
44235823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dcfd89715d148f42afa8452a239e989d1d41b70 OP_EQUAL
address
38nSwiEk5SYR8k6qbwBpBmXez8VjFQurPN
transaction
57d82dd80d4e6c9d3005cce9e9dd5df5a4820cb0ceedc3eb102f136cc669c8ed
confirmations
323023
spent
true